The Cherry Mobile Superion Vector features a WSVGA IPS display, quad core processor, and 1GB RAM. Being a Superion tablet, it also comes with call and text capabilities, not to mention support for HSPA+ mobile data connectivity. However, what really wowed me was its whopping 16GB of internal storage. And this is for a tablet that now only sells for Php4,999 the last time I checked!

Cherry Mobile Superion Vector Specs

  • 7″ WSVGA IPS display (600 x 1,024 resolution, 170ppi)
  • 1.3GHz quad core processor
  • Android 4.2 Jelly Bean
  • 1GB RAM
  • 16GB ROM, expandable via micro SD up to 64GB
  • 5mp rear camera
  • 2mp front camera
  • 3.75G/HSPA+
  • WiFi
  • Bluetooth
  • GPS with A-GPS
  • USB OTG support
  • 2,500mAh battery
  • Price: Php4,999 as of writing

    1. Hi Kattie,

      As a student, I’d probably go for the Cherry Mobile Alpha Play. It’s a tablet that runs full Windows, not Android, so you can actually use it for real productivity. It even comes with a free Bluetooth keyboard and Microsoft Office. It only comes with 16GB storage, which isn’t much on a Windows device. After the OS and updates, you’ll only be left with about 4GB of usable storage left. You can get a micro SD card for files, but you can’t install apps on that card. The Alpha Play is only selling for Php5,999 these days. Here’s a link to my hands on with the Alpha Play.
